The speculation can now be put to rest—Arbaaz Khan has confirmed that he and his wife, Sshura Khan, are expecting their first child. In recent days, the internet was abuzz after Sshura was photographed outside a Mumbai clinic, her appearance hinting at a possible pregnancy.

While the couple remained tight-lipped initially, Arbaaz has now addressed the rumours and shared the happy news, marking a new chapter in their journey together.

Confirming the news, Arbaaz told Times of India, “Yes, it is there. I'm not denying that information because right now it's something that is out there, my family knows about it. People have got to know about it, and it's fine. It's pretty evident also. It's a very exciting time in both our lives. We are happy and excited. We're going to welcome this new life in our life.”

This will be Arbaaz’s second child and Sshura’s first. Arbaaz. He first welcomed his first son, Arhaan Khan, with ex-wife Malaika Arora, in 2002. As Arbaaz is ready to step into the shoes of a father once again. When asked about how he feels to be a father again, the actor said, “Everybody tends to be nervous. Any person would feel (the nerves); I'm also getting into fatherhood now after some time. It's a fresh new feeling for me all over again. I'm excited. I'm happy and I'm looking forward. It's just giving me a new sense of happiness or responsibility. I'm kind of liking that.”

While he and Sshura are all excited about welcoming their little one very soon into this world, Arbaaz also said that he hopes to be attentive, loving, caring, be around for their kid, and to provide the best for their child once the baby arrives.

About Arbaaz and Sshura’s relationship:

The soon-to-be parents first met on the sets of ‘Patna Shulka’, a legal drama starring Raveen Tandon, which released in 2024, and was backed by Arbaaz. After dating for a year, the couple decided to take their relationship to the next level. They eventually got married on December 24, 2023, in Mumbai. Their marriage, attended by close family and friends, was held at sister Arpita Khan Sharma’s residence.
